Output 44c14696317492f85092d0d3a259260f162e6528a370c2128478495ebad43eba:0

value
465687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8526b9478c9cb0efaaff695d86fa1189824c89de OP_EQUAL
address
3Dq4BdWrM7WvbBQ8QLfLtSpzj93858mPF8
transaction
44c14696317492f85092d0d3a259260f162e6528a370c2128478495ebad43eba
spent
true